Boards Made from Birch Veneer

Due to its strength and uniform thickness, Birch plywood has many practical uses. It's common application spans the realms of construction, including in cupboards, tables, doors, walls, and even ceilings.

As with other types of plywood, birch plywood may be found in a variety of thicknesses. Plywood typically comes in four-foot-by-eight-foot rectangles. It is also produced as laminated veneer lumber and uni-directional lumber core.

As a kind of plywood, birch is known for its pristine finish and crisp lines. Lighter shades of wood provide a more rustic appeal. Also, it is a great option for woodwork patterns.

UV coatings or varnishes are common treatments for birch plywood. Finishes like rough and sanded are also an option. It also has practical uses in the business world.

Because of its adaptability, birch plywood is frequently used to make lights. Due to its lightweight and moisture-resistant nature, this wood is a great choice for outdoor use. Also, it comes in a variety of sizes, so you can use it in all sorts of creative ways.
